混合学习在“网页编程基础”课程教学中的应用.doc

上传人:3d66 文档编号:1849529 上传时间:2019-01-12 格式:DOC 页数:7 大小:18KB
返回 下载 相关 举报
混合学习在“网页编程基础”课程教学中的应用.doc_第1页
第1页 / 共7页
混合学习在“网页编程基础”课程教学中的应用.doc_第2页
第2页 / 共7页
混合学习在“网页编程基础”课程教学中的应用.doc_第3页
第3页 / 共7页
亲,该文档总共7页,到这儿已超出免费预览范围,如果喜欢就下载吧!
资源描述

《混合学习在“网页编程基础”课程教学中的应用.doc》由会员分享,可在线阅读,更多相关《混合学习在“网页编程基础”课程教学中的应用.doc(7页珍藏版)》请在三一文库上搜索。

1、混合学习在“网页编程基础”课程教学中的应用 针对当代学生对网络和网页的知识越来越丰富,传统的课程教学方式不能满足学生要求的问题,本文将混合教学模式应用到网页课程教学设计中,提出一种以学生在线学习为主,结合课堂教学和网络答疑,并采用让学生分组完成项目的教学评价方法,取得了较好教学效果。 在网络时代,各种类型的网站随处可见,各种样式美观的网页激发学生强烈的兴趣,使得网页类课程成为高校中热门的选修课程。通常的网页教学课程大多偏重于网页页面设计,主要采用Dreamweaver等工具进行教学。而我校的本门课程偏重于培养学生在网页中的编程能力,为今后学生进一步学习高级的动态网页编程及获得建立完整网站项目的

2、能力打下基础,这就对该课程的教学提出了更高的要求。对于“网页编程基础”这门操作性比较强的课程,传统的教学方法已经不能满足教学需要,因此我们根据网页编程的特点采用了一种以E-learning结合课堂讲授的混合学习教学方法,获得了较好效果。 1混合式学习及其比较优势 在传统单一的教学方式中,课堂教学有利于教师主导作用的发挥,有利于教师监控整个教学活动进程,有利于系统科学知识的传授,有利于教学目标的完成。但在网页教学中,单一的课堂教学会造成大多数学生对教学内容难以及时消化,黑板式教学和口授言讲式教学使学生难以建立对网页编程直观的认识,无法解决现实网页设计中所需的程序设计问题。由于传统的教学方法没有以

3、学生为中心,而是教师的单向的填鸭式教学,阻碍了学生学习的主观能动性和创造性。 E-learning是随着信息技术的发展而产生的全新学习方式,由于E-learning具有学习不受时间、地域 限制,可以实现教育资源充分共享的优势,使E-learning得以产生并在高等教育中迅速发展。但单纯采用E-learning的教学方式也存在诸多不足,如缺少人际交互易产生厌倦情绪,教学效果不够理想,缺少适应学习者需要的定制课程,缺少角色扮演活动,降低了学习内容的应用价值等1。 混合式学习是一种结合传统的课堂学习和E-learning的教学模式。它避免了单纯以教师为中心或者以学生为中心的学习观念,既充分体现学生作

4、为学习主体的主动性、积极性和创造性,又发挥教师的引导、启发、监控教学过程的主导作用,强调学生主体地位和教师主导作用的有机统一。通过两者的优势互补,从而能够获得单纯的课堂讲授与网上个别化学习都不能达到预期的效果2-3。 混合式学习所具有的优势已经得到业界的认可,也获得了广泛的研究和关注,如Monterey公司也在实例研究的基础上提出了混合式学习模型 (The Blended Learning Model in Action); Prime Learning网站也提出了混合式学习程序 (Blended Learning Programs);贝克大学在Black Board公司提供的工具帮助下,进行

5、混合式学习的探索;美国斯坦福大学和田纳西州立大学等正在进行混合式学习效果方面的研究。美国宾州大学校长也指出在线学习跟课堂教学的融合,即混合式学习,是高等教育最重要的发展趋势4-6。 基金项目北京工业大学教育教学项目(70005141911)。 桂智明(1976-),男,讲师,博士,研究方向为Web挖掘等;宋凯(1958-),女,副教授,硕士,研究方向 为数据库等。 2混合学习在网页编程教学中的应用 2.1教学设计思路 针对网页编程教学的特点,以及学生对网页接触和了解已经有了一定基础的实际情况,我们设计了一种以E-learning为主的混合式教学方案。该方案以学生在线自学为主,通过各种搜索引擎以

6、及网络上丰富的数字化教学资源和各种交互工具、认知工具的有力支持,培养学生的自主探究学习网页编程的能力。通过课堂上的教学演示和对学生作业的点评来发挥教师的一定主导作用,加强教师对学习活动的设计、调控,给予学习者提示、鼓励并且提供相应的方法,并在合适的时候能够进行评价,并通过教学反馈及时修改教学进度和学习方案,该方案的总体设计思路如图1。 图1教学设计思路 2.2教学方案的实施 在实际教学过程中,我们采用了如下方案。在课堂理论教学上,对于网页中的编程方法的讲解,我们注重于结合实际代码运行效果演示的代码分析和解释,如在讲解网页中事件模型时,对于网页中的“oncopy, mouseclick,onpr

7、ecopy”等等事件触发及响应过程都用实际操作和设置相应的提示信息来进行阐述,一步步说明代码的运行过程和运行情况,从原理上阐明浏览器如何处理与用户的交互和响应过程,这样不但能够加强学生的理解,还能够使学生获得直观的认识。我们还加强对于网页的实例分析,如对于层叠样式表CSS的讲解,我们以实际从新浪、搜狐等一些知名网站上下载的CSS为例进行实际分析和讲解,并要求学生抽取其中的部分内容应用到自己设计的网页中去,加强学生的理解。并要求学生在浏览网页时将设计优秀的网页中的CSS保存下来,进行分析,最终应用到实际作业项目中。 在课堂实践教学上,为了了解学生的实际理解和掌握情况,我们在学生练习中采用了网上在

8、线测试的方法。通过一些能够直接运行和显示整体网页代码效果的网站,要求学生在网站上现场键入HTML代码和JavaScript代码,并在线演示和说明,教师针对其中的错误给予讲解和分析。这种方法也较好地监控和督促了学生的学习过程。由于本门课程注重于培养学生的实际动手能力,我们按照所讲授内容的顺序,分四个阶段有针对性地安排了不同的实践作业,这四个阶段分别是HTML基础;网页布局和样式;网页事件模型;JavaScript编程。不同阶段的作业虽然只包含该阶段所讲授的内容,但作业之间是按照一个完整项目分解而成,不同作业最终可组装成一个完整的网站。在整个教学实施过程当中,我们的教学反馈和调整也是根据不同阶段实

9、践作业的完成情况进行,根据作业检查获得的学习情况,修改下一阶段的教学内容和进度安排。 对于课程的教学评价和考核,我们的思路是结合实践教学中的作业,要求学生利用已经完成的作业内容,开发一个相对完整的在线调查网站,根据开发的效果和功能完整程度进行最后的成绩评定。除了必须完成的指定功能外,在线调查的内容、方式以及网页风格等由学生自己预先阐述设计思想,教师从可实现性、工作量、内容完整性等角度进行修正。学生以3人1组的方式进行协作开发,小组成员根据自己的特长进行分工,前期的素材收集、图片编辑、Flash 动画制作及网站设计及JavaScript编程等,最后完成项目。在项目进行过程中,学生可以自己搜索相关

10、资料,也可以利用论坛、Email给老师留言和提问,也可能在指定时间用QQ、MSN和飞信等和教师在线交流,老师可以通过网上答疑的方式解决问题。在这种情境下,学生不会拘束,学生也可以即时在网上验证答疑结果,使得传授的知识利于被学生理解和接受,也培养了学生的团队意识。学期结束时,要求每一组的代表简要讲解其作品,由教师从创意、审美、内容、技术、工作量五个角度进行点评,最终结合学生平时学习情况给出学生本学期的考查成绩。 在整个混合教学实施过程中,我们也发现,虽然现在学生有很强的通过网络学习和解决问题的能力,但对于抽象问题的定位和理解还需要提高,需要教师定位到具体实际问题并定制学习内容,否则在由于不知解决

11、什么问题且没有与教师现场交流的情境下,很难掌握并运用网上的知识,容易产生厌倦情绪。这也说明在混合教学实施过程中要更好地调整课堂教学与学生自身网络学习之间的关系。 3结语 混合式学习是高等教育最重要的发展趋势,能够 获得单纯的课堂讲授与网上个别化学习都不能达到预期的效果7-8。教师在混合式教学模式下既可以通过基于网络的课堂进行教,又可以课后完成备课、布置作业、批改作业、答疑等教学活动。学生除了课堂学习外,课后可以自主在线学习、在线做作业、讨论协作、在线答疑等。这种模式既可以发挥教师的主导作用,又可以满足学生自主学习的需要。混合式学习所具有的优势已经得到业界的认可,对于网页编程这门与网络紧密相关的课程,在当前学生都具备较好计算机基础的情况下,采用混合式教学的优势更加突出。当然,混合式学习的优势并非自然而然就能产生的,还需要精心地设计和实施,随着当代学生对网页的接触和认识越来越丰富,在混合式网页教学设计中应进一步强调和关注个体的知识潜力和学习行为。 第 7 页

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> 其他


经营许可证编号:宁ICP备18001539号-1